D-Mannose is a white powder. It is a carbohydrate that plays an important role in the process of human metabolism, especially in the glycosylation of specific proteins.

D-mannose, the only glyconutrient used clinically, is widely distributed in body fluids and tissues, especially in the nerves, skin, testes, retina, liver and intestines. It is directly used to synthesize glycoproteins and participate in immune regulation. Many diseases are caused by the lack of enzymes in mannose glycation.
Its physiological effects in the human body are as follows:
1) Regulate the immune system
2) There are 4 kinds of receptors on the surface of macrophages that can capture antigens, all of which have mannose components
3) Increase wound healing
4) Anti-inflammatory effect
5) Inhibit tumor growth and metastasis, increase cancer survival rate
6) Certain bacterial infections, such as urinary tract infections, can be avoided
